The investment seeks long-term growth of capital. The fund ordinarily invests at least 80% of its net assets (plus any borrowings made for investment purposes) in equity securities, including common stocks and preferred stocks. Under normal market conditions, it will invest at least 80% of its net assets (plus any borrowings made for investment purposes) in securities of U.S. issuers. The fund's approach to equity investing combines the styles of two subadvisers in selecting securities for each of the fund's segments.
